Ubisoft Ceasing Online Services For Select Wii And Wii U Titles

Ubisoft has announced they will be ceasing online services for a couple of their older titles that were released on Wii U and Wii.

Once online services for those titles are shut down on November 11, 2017, players will no longer be able to play them online, access Uplay on those games, or view any in-game news or stats.

The list of affected titles can be found below.

  • Splinter Cell Blacklist WIIU
  • Just Dance 4 WIIU
  • Just Dance Disney Party WII
  • Marvel Avenger Battle for Earth WIIU
  • Rabbids Land WIIU
  • Your Shape Fitness Evolved 2013 WIIU
  • ESPN Sport Connections WIIU
